BBC - History - British History in depth: The 1908 London Olympics Gallery

Miss Sybil Fenton 'Queenie' Newall, winner of the 1908 Olympic ladies Archery event.  Winning 4 months short of her 54th birthday, she still holds the record as the oldest woman to win an Olympic gold medal.

London 2012 Olympics: Great Britain take boxing and fencing golds in week of test events - Telegraph

In London 1908 the British Olympics boxers did pretty well too – the Edwardian Team GB won bronze, silver and gold in the Bantamweight, Featherweight, Lightweight and Heavyweight classes. But then in the first London Olympics of 1908, things were rather loaded in favour of the hosts. Of 42 boxers competing, 32 of them were British. Only 2 Danes, 7 Frenchmen and an Australian stood against them. Qudos to the sole Australian - the legendary Reginald “Snowy” Baker – who managed to break the GBR stranglehold by winning silver in the Middleweight class.

Cycling: London Olympics 2012: Ross Edgar may be key to Team ...

Cycling: London Olympics 2012...  GB cyclists were top in the 1st London Olympics in 1908.  Despite the weather being 'the reverse of pleasant. As a matter of fact, it was the rule rather than the exception for the track to be flooded.'  Riding outside on a concrete track, team GB won 5 gold medals, 3 silvers and 1 bronze medal.
